Product Description

The GI200G-B0-IMU is an inertial measurement unit (IMU) based on micromachining technology (MEMS), with built-in high-performance MEMS gyroscope and MEMS accelerometer, outputting 3 angular velocities and 3 accelerations.

GI200G-B0-IMU has high reliability and strong environmental adaptability. By matching different software, the product can be widely used in tactical and industrial UAV, smart ammunition, seeker and other fields.

Main Functions
  • Three-axis digital gyroscope:
    • ±500º/s (MAX:±2000 °/s) dynamic measurement range
    • Zero bias stability: 10 °/h (GJB, 10s), 2.0 °/h (ALLAN)
  • Triaxial digital accelerometer:
    • ±16g (MAX:±200g) dynamic measuring range
    • Zero-bias stability: 0.5mg (GJB, 10s), 0.1mg (ALLAN)
  • High reliability: MTBF > 20000h
  • Guaranteed accuracy within the full temperature range (-40 ℃ ~ 80 ℃): built-in high-performance temperature calibration and compensation algorithm
  • Suitable for working under strong vibration conditions
  • Interface 1-channel UART

Electrical Interface

GI200G-B0-IMU adopts 6PIN domestic connector with locking function for interconnection. Interface model: A1008 WR-S-6P, the recommended mating terminal is A1008H-6P + A1008-T/G or 5013300600 (6p) + 5013340000.
